> When parsing some dwg items, it is possible that the parser may cause itself 
> to go into an infinite loop.
> Attached is the file causing the problem.
> Here is a possible patch that will at least proceed until an error is thrown.
> {noformat}
> === modified file 
> 'tika-parsers/src/main/java/org/apache/tika/parser/dwg/DWGParser.java'
> --- tika-parsers/src/main/java/org/apache/tika/parser/dwg/DWGParser.java      
>   2011-11-24 11:30:33 +0000
> +++ tika-parsers/src/main/java/org/apache/tika/parser/dwg/DWGParser.java      
>   2011-11-25 05:27:41 +0000
> @@ -274,8 +274,10 @@
>              return false;
>          }
>          while (toSkip > 0) {
> -            byte[] skip = new byte[Math.min((int) toSkip, 0x4000)];
> -            IOUtils.readFully(stream, skip);
> +            byte[] skip = new byte[(int) Math.min(toSkip, 0x4000)];
> +            if (IOUtils.readFully(stream, skip) == -1) {
> +               return false; //invalid skip
> +            }
>              toSkip -= skip.length;
>          }
>          return true;
> {noformat}
